Vb. Matyushichev et al., EXOGENOUS GANGLIOSIDES MODIFY BIOCHEMICAL-CHANGES ASSOCIATED WITH THEDEVELOPMENT OF FETAL CHICKEN NERVOUS-TISSUE IN CULTURE, Biochemistry, 59(10), 1994, pp. 1103-1107
Effects of exogenous ganglioside G(M1) (1 mu M) from bovine brain on m
orphology and biochemical characteristics (creatine kinase, acetylchol
ine esterase, and adenylate cyclase activity; content of proteins, pho
spholipids, and gangliosides) of cells were studied in mixed primary c
ultures of fetal chicken brain. Introduction of the ganglioside into t
he culture medium accelerated cell growth and differentiation. The con
tent of phospho- and glycolipids in such cells was increased. In addit
ion, the ganglioside stimulated the activity of several enzymes.
